KDOT is currently hiring an Administrative Specialist for the District Three Office in Norton, Kansas.
Job responsibilities may include but are not limited to:
- Assists in the recruitment process for the district, which includes answering questions from the public on open positions, scheduling interviews when needed, reviewing requisition files for completion, and maintaining the district position tracking spreadsheet.
- Responsible for communicating district training and registering employees in classes in the Learning Management System (LMS) and coordinating with the ODU team in the Bureau of Human Resources to establish courses.
- Responsible for tracking district employee performance review program, prepare reports and distribute to supervisors and managers for notification and tracking.
- Prepare and process Family Medical Leave Act (FMLA) and Parental Leave requests through Bureau of Human Resources.
- Entering personnel transactions, i.e., new appointments, promotions, transfers, demotions, terminations, retirements, pay increases, leave without pay and return from leave without pay, address changes, tax withholdings and exemptions, direct deposits, etc., for district complex employees. Analyzes new Shared Leave requests, reviews for completeness, calculates hours needed for committee review, and completes processing.
- Provide payroll assistance in reviewing KDOT Employee Time Confirmation Report, and Preliminary Warrant Register for correct entries and pay adjustments, verifying district complex time and payroll transactions and adjustments, correcting leave discrepancies, compute correct leave balances to determine corrective action.
